About Sunyue Ye

Sunyue Ye is a scholar working on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health, Education, Developmental and Educational Psychology, Sociology and Political Science and Physiology, having authored 17 papers that have together received 316 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Obesity, Physical Activity, Diet (8 papers), Children's Physical and Motor Development (6 papers), Impact of Technology on Adolescents (5 papers), Child Development and Digital Technology (5 papers), Nutritional Studies and Diet (3 papers), Eating Disorders and Behaviors (2 papers), Gender and Technology in Education (2 papers) and Physical Activity and Health (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Medical Laboratory Technology (22 citations), Occupational Therapy (39 citations), Physical Therapy, Sports Therapy and Rehabilitation (26 citations), Pharmacology (88 citations) and Developmental and Educational Psychology (60 citations). Sunyue Ye has collaborated with scholars based in China, United States and Taiwan. Frequent co-authors include Wei Chen, Jie Lu, Zan Gao, Jung Eun Lee, David F. Stodden, Lijian Chen, Shankuan Zhu, Min Yang, Da Gan and Zachary Pope. Their work appears in journals such as BMJ Open, BMC Public Health, International Journal of Environmental Research and Public Health, Sleep Medicine and Journal of Clinical Medicine.
